[發(fā)明專(zhuān)利]可編程控制的SDN網(wǎng)絡(luò)測(cè)量系統(tǒng)和測(cè)量方法有效
| 申請(qǐng)?zhí)枺?/td> | 201410074572.4 | 申請(qǐng)日: | 2014-03-03 |
| 公開(kāi)(公告)號(hào): | CN103795596B | 公開(kāi)(公告)日: | 2017-05-24 |
| 發(fā)明(設(shè)計(jì))人: | 王文東;龔向陽(yáng);闕喜戎;羅瑞龍 | 申請(qǐng)(專(zhuān)利權(quán))人: | 北京郵電大學(xué) |
| 主分類(lèi)號(hào): | H04L12/26 | 分類(lèi)號(hào): | H04L12/26;H04L12/947 |
| 代理公司: | 北京德琦知識(shí)產(chǎn)權(quán)代理有限公司11018 | 代理人: | 夏憲富 |
| 地址: | 100876 *** | 國(guó)省代碼: | 北京;11 |
| 權(quán)利要求書(shū): | 查看更多 | 說(shuō)明書(shū): |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 可編程 控制 sdn 網(wǎng)絡(luò) 測(cè)量 系統(tǒng) 測(cè)量方法 | ||
1.一種可編程控制的軟件定義網(wǎng)絡(luò)SDN(Software Defined Network)測(cè)量系統(tǒng),包括有:網(wǎng)絡(luò)控制層的網(wǎng)絡(luò)控制器和數(shù)據(jù)傳輸層的底層交換機(jī);其特征在于:該系統(tǒng)還設(shè)有:網(wǎng)絡(luò)應(yīng)用層增設(shè)的兩個(gè)組成部件:可編程控制的測(cè)量組件和支持測(cè)量組件的適配模塊,以及將數(shù)據(jù)傳輸層的底層交換機(jī)增設(shè)三個(gè)部件而改進(jìn)為可編程控制的交換機(jī);其中:
可編程控制的測(cè)量組件,是基于支持測(cè)量組件的適配模塊提供的、針對(duì)SDN網(wǎng)絡(luò)測(cè)量的應(yīng)用程序接口API(Application Programming Interfaces)開(kāi)發(fā)的部件,負(fù)責(zé)測(cè)量任務(wù)的管理,其功能包括:一是通過(guò)其設(shè)置的涵蓋多種算法的測(cè)量算法庫(kù),以供測(cè)量人員根據(jù)不同測(cè)量任務(wù)選擇適宜的算法,并定制相應(yīng)的系列操作,然后將任務(wù)參數(shù)和操作指令下發(fā)至可編程控制的交換機(jī),指導(dǎo)其工作;二是根據(jù)可編程控制的交換機(jī)上報(bào)的測(cè)量數(shù)據(jù)計(jì)算并存儲(chǔ)測(cè)量結(jié)果;三是給可編程控制的交換機(jī)下發(fā)攜帶有測(cè)量操作指令代碼的操作配置信息,控制測(cè)量任務(wù)的處理過(guò)程;且在基本測(cè)量操作無(wú)法滿(mǎn)足測(cè)量任務(wù)時(shí),該測(cè)量組件能夠根據(jù)測(cè)量類(lèi)型和測(cè)量算法的具體要求,自定義測(cè)量操作的處理過(guò)程,并通過(guò)OpenFlow協(xié)議下發(fā)至可編程控制的交換機(jī),在流表匹配成功后,執(zhí)行相應(yīng)操作,實(shí)現(xiàn)對(duì)探測(cè)包的處理;
可編程控制的交換機(jī),負(fù)責(zé)對(duì)進(jìn)入該可編程控制的交換機(jī)的數(shù)據(jù)流根據(jù)不同流表的匹配結(jié)果,有效區(qū)分探測(cè)包或普通數(shù)據(jù)的流量,再執(zhí)行相應(yīng)操作,實(shí)現(xiàn)探測(cè)包可編程控制的處理,完成測(cè)量任務(wù);該可編程控制的交換機(jī)功能包括:根據(jù)測(cè)量任務(wù)的參數(shù)執(zhí)行規(guī)定操作來(lái)構(gòu)造探測(cè)包,并存儲(chǔ)在測(cè)量隊(duì)列中等待發(fā)送;完成探測(cè)包的發(fā)送、轉(zhuǎn)發(fā)和接收,以及測(cè)量數(shù)據(jù)的提取和上報(bào);還具有擴(kuò)展功能:允許編程自定義新的測(cè)量操作并部署在該可編程控制的交換機(jī)中,以使測(cè)量人員能以編程控制方式更便利地執(zhí)行測(cè)量任務(wù);該可編程控制的交換機(jī)是在底層交換機(jī)基礎(chǔ)上增設(shè)下述三個(gè)部件:可編程的測(cè)量操作庫(kù)、可編程的測(cè)量模塊和測(cè)量隊(duì)列管理模塊構(gòu)成的;
支持測(cè)量組件的適配模塊,也是利用針對(duì)網(wǎng)絡(luò)測(cè)量的SDN API進(jìn)行封裝構(gòu)建而成,負(fù)責(zé)在可編程控制的測(cè)量組件和網(wǎng)絡(luò)控制器之間傳送信息,并提供專(zhuān)用于網(wǎng)絡(luò)測(cè)量業(yè)務(wù)的SDN API,以供技術(shù)開(kāi)發(fā)人員采用SDN技術(shù)設(shè)計(jì)可編程控制的測(cè)量組件,實(shí)現(xiàn)網(wǎng)絡(luò)測(cè)量業(yè)務(wù)的邏輯控制;網(wǎng)絡(luò)控制器注冊(cè)一個(gè)測(cè)量事件后,就能使所有測(cè)量消息經(jīng)由網(wǎng)絡(luò)控制器在可編程控制的測(cè)量組件和可編程控制的交換機(jī)之間交互,且在交互過(guò)程中,該適配模塊負(fù)責(zé)兩項(xiàng)操作:一是針對(duì)測(cè)量組件下發(fā)的任務(wù)參數(shù)進(jìn)行封裝,并通過(guò)網(wǎng)絡(luò)控制器下發(fā)至可編程控制的交換機(jī)中;二是針對(duì)可編程控制的交換機(jī)上報(bào)的測(cè)量數(shù)據(jù)進(jìn)行解析,以方便可編程控制的測(cè)量組件對(duì)數(shù)據(jù)進(jìn)行處理。
2.根據(jù)權(quán)利要求1所述的SDN測(cè)量系統(tǒng),其特征在于:所述測(cè)量算法庫(kù)不僅存儲(chǔ)有用于測(cè)量包括時(shí)延和帶寬的不同網(wǎng)絡(luò)性能指標(biāo)的多種測(cè)量算法,還允許用戶(hù)自定義而添加其它測(cè)量算法,用于擴(kuò)充現(xiàn)有的測(cè)量算法庫(kù),實(shí)現(xiàn)多種網(wǎng)絡(luò)性能指標(biāo)的測(cè)量。
3.根據(jù)權(quán)利要求1所述的SDN測(cè)量系統(tǒng),其特征在于:所述可編程控制的交換機(jī)構(gòu)造的網(wǎng)絡(luò)測(cè)量任務(wù)的探測(cè)包的內(nèi)容、大小、發(fā)送個(gè)數(shù)和發(fā)送時(shí)間間隔的各項(xiàng)參數(shù)都是根據(jù)檢測(cè)的不同網(wǎng)絡(luò)性能指標(biāo)而決定的,雖然每個(gè)探測(cè)包的各項(xiàng)參數(shù)互不相同,但對(duì)探測(cè)包執(zhí)行的多種測(cè)量操作作為基本的測(cè)量操作而添加到交換機(jī)的可編程的測(cè)量操作庫(kù)中;還能以軟件定義方式將新操作的指令代碼通過(guò)OpenFlow協(xié)議下發(fā)給交換機(jī),從而實(shí)現(xiàn)網(wǎng)絡(luò)測(cè)量的可編程控制,能夠更好地支持網(wǎng)絡(luò)測(cè)量。
該專(zhuān)利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專(zhuān)利權(quán)人授權(quán)。該專(zhuān)利全部權(quán)利屬于北京郵電大學(xué),未經(jīng)北京郵電大學(xué)許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買(mǎi)此專(zhuān)利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410074572.4/1.html,轉(zhuǎn)載請(qǐng)聲明來(lái)源鉆瓜專(zhuān)利網(wǎng)。
- 一種隔離SDN協(xié)議報(bào)文和數(shù)據(jù)報(bào)文的方法及裝置
- 一種基于SDN的支持QoS的通信隧道建立方法及系統(tǒng)
- 一種SDN流轉(zhuǎn)發(fā)的數(shù)量限制方法和控制系統(tǒng)
- 軟件定義網(wǎng)絡(luò)(SDN)特定拓?fù)湫畔l(fā)現(xiàn)
- SDN控制器與SDN交換機(jī)的連接控制方法以及SDN控制器系統(tǒng)
- 流表處理方法、流表處理裝置以及SDN網(wǎng)絡(luò)系統(tǒng)
- 一種SDN節(jié)點(diǎn)間可信認(rèn)證方法
- SDN網(wǎng)絡(luò)丟包判斷方法、裝置、系統(tǒng)和多網(wǎng)絡(luò)控制系統(tǒng)
- 基于K8S平臺(tái)納管SDN的方法、系統(tǒng)以及存儲(chǔ)介質(zhì)
- 一種SDN網(wǎng)絡(luò)與非SDN網(wǎng)絡(luò)通信的裝置
- 網(wǎng)絡(luò)和網(wǎng)絡(luò)終端
- 網(wǎng)絡(luò)DNA
- 網(wǎng)絡(luò)地址自適應(yīng)系統(tǒng)和方法及應(yīng)用系統(tǒng)和方法
- 網(wǎng)絡(luò)系統(tǒng)及網(wǎng)絡(luò)至網(wǎng)絡(luò)橋接器
- 一種電力線網(wǎng)絡(luò)中根節(jié)點(diǎn)網(wǎng)絡(luò)協(xié)調(diào)方法和系統(tǒng)
- 一種多網(wǎng)絡(luò)定位方法、存儲(chǔ)介質(zhì)及移動(dòng)終端
- 網(wǎng)絡(luò)裝置、網(wǎng)絡(luò)系統(tǒng)、網(wǎng)絡(luò)方法以及網(wǎng)絡(luò)程序
- 從重復(fù)網(wǎng)絡(luò)地址自動(dòng)恢復(fù)的方法、網(wǎng)絡(luò)設(shè)備及其存儲(chǔ)介質(zhì)
- 神經(jīng)網(wǎng)絡(luò)的訓(xùn)練方法、裝置及存儲(chǔ)介質(zhì)
- 網(wǎng)絡(luò)管理方法和裝置





